What management is focused on

Priorities management has stated in recent disclosures, with status and evidence drawn from earnings calls, filings, and press releases.

  • #1

    Increase Seniors Housing Operating NOI

    Growth

    Focus on increasing the NOI for Seniors Housing Operating through strategic investments and management.

    Mixed

    Stated in 2 of last 2 quarters. Seniors Housing Operating NOI increased by 22.1% from $435.7M in 1Q25 to $531.8M in 1Q26, showing strong growth. The trajectory is delivering on management's stated focus on increasing NOI in this segment.

    63%
    CEO/CFO:Seniors Housing Operating NOI increased by 22.1% from 1Q25 to 1Q26.

  • #2

    Enhance Outpatient Medical Occupancy

    Growth

    Improve occupancy rates in the Outpatient Medical segment to maximize revenue potential.

    Behind

    Stated in 2 of last 2 quarters. Outpatient Medical occupancy increased from 95.5% in 4Q25 to 96.9% in 1Q26, indicating progress in maximizing revenue potential. The trajectory shows improvement in occupancy rates as management intended.

    0%
    CEO/CFO:Outpatient Medical occupancy increased to 96.9% in 1Q26.
